Job Description


We at Krista Care believe in a client first approach. We are looking for compassionate people to work with Krista Care. We are more than just a team as we treat each other as family. If you are looking for a company that will treat you like family, then Krista Care is for you!

The core of this position is the coordination of caregivers and client's schedules, ensuring the client's needs are met in a professional and timely manner. This position will also maintain employee records for compliance purposes, while working together with a small team.

1 Maintain Patient Assignment Lists

2 Manage Administration records with all insurance carriers

3 Guide and coach Caregivers on best practices

4 Provide Performance Appraisals for Caregivers at specified intervals

5 Assign the best Caregiver for each client, filling all open shifts, while provide consistent quality care, and providing reports to upper management.

6 Oversee the following:

Quality Insurance

Inquiry Calls

Assessments

Performs annual performance reviews for office employees and/or caregivers

Participate in on-call rotation to answer inbound calls

7 - Participate in hiring, coaching, and assessing the performance of administrative and direct care employees

8 Develop, in collaboration with the CEO, a Marketing and Sales Plan to include strategies for maintaining and growing the local markets in the Los Angeles, San Bernardino County, Riverside County and Orange County

9- Recruiting:

  • Sourcing and Screening: Identifying potential candidates through various channels, including job boards, social media, databases, and referrals.
  • Interviewing: Conducting initial and follow-up interviews to assess candidates' qualifications, skills, and fit.
  • Onboarding: Assisting with the onboarding process for new hires.
  • Legal Compliance: Ensuring that all recruiting activities comply with relevant laws and regulations.
About Krista Care LLC:

Krista Care LLC is a home care agency based in Arcadia, California, dedicated to enhancing the quality of life and promoting maximum independence for seniors, individuals with disabilities, and those requiring in-home assistance. Their mission centers on providing compassionate, personalized care that allows clients to remain safely and comfortably in their own homes.
